Pool Water Treatment Systems Compared

Understanding where water structuring fits in your pool system requires comparing it to the alternatives pool owners typically research.

Key Insight for Pool Owners

If you're researching how to reduce chlorine in your pool, systems like mineral sanitizers, UV, and ozone are designed specifically for that purpose. These systems can reduce chlorine requirements by 50-90% while maintaining sanitation.

The Pool Revitalizer serves a different function: it works alongside your existing sanitation system (whether that's chlorine, salt, UV, or minerals) to influence water structure and feel. It does not reduce chlorine requirements, filter contaminants, or replace sanitation.

Many pool owners use structured water systems in combination with chlorine-reducing technologies—for example, pairing a UV system (which handles sanitation with less chlorine) with a structured water unit (which addresses water feel and comfort).

How does it compare to UV systems or mineral sanitizers?

UV systems and mineral sanitizers are designed to reduce chlorine use by handling part of the sanitation workload. UV can reduce chlorine needs by up to 80%, while mineral systems typically reduce chlorine by 50%. The Pool Revitalizer serves a different function—it addresses water structure and feel, not sanitation. Many pool owners use both: a UV or mineral system to reduce chlorine, plus a structured water unit to improve water comfort.
